# | KPI Name | Description |
---|---|---|
1 | Default Rate Prediction Accuracy | Measures the precision of default probability predictions influenced by data quality, model sophistication, and machine learning. |
2 | Customer Retention Rate | Indicates the percentage of customers who continue using the platform, directly impacting subscription revenue stability. |
3 | Net Promoter Score (NPS) | Gauges client satisfaction and likelihood to recommend the platform, ensuring strong client relationships and identifying service improvement areas. |
4 | Cost per Acquisition (CPA) | Measures the cost involved in acquiring a new customer, vital for budgeting and assessing marketing strategy efficiency. |
5 | Data Processing Time | Tracks the average time taken to process and analyze data inputs, critical for operational efficiency and timely delivery of insights. |

KPI 2: Customer Retention Rate
Definition
Customer Retention Rate measures the percentage of customers who continue to subscribe to CreditSense Analytics over a given period. This metric is critical for ensuring stable subscription revenue and reflects overall customer satisfaction and support responsiveness.
Advantages
- Stable Revenue: A high retention rate directly boosts recurring revenue and attracts investor confidence.
- Improved Service Quality: Insights from retention data can drive better user satisfaction and targeted support improvements.
- Data-Driven Decisions: Enhances decision-making by indicating the effectiveness of customer engagement and subscription pricing strategies.
Disadvantages
- Limited Churn Insight: It does not fully reveal why customers leave the platform.
- Delayed Feedback: Changes in customer retention may reflect issues that emerged much earlier.
- Dependency on External Factors: Market changes and competitive moves can affect retention independent of service quality.
Industry Benchmarks
In subscription-based credit risk assessment solutions, a strong Customer Retention Rate typically ranges from 80% to 90%, depending on market competitiveness and service quality. These benchmarks provide a valuable standard against which you can measure performance and identify growth opportunities.
How To Improve
- Enhance customer support responsiveness through improved training and technology.
- Implement proactive engagement campaigns to gather continuous feedback and address concerns swiftly.
- Utilize data-driven insights to personalize customer experiences and boost retention rates.
How To Calculate
Calculate Customer Retention Rate by taking the number of existing customers at the end of a period, subtracting the new customers acquired, dividing by the number of customers at the start, and multiplying by 100 to obtain a percentage.
Example of Calculation
If you started with 200 customers, added 30 new ones, and ended with 180 customers, your calculation would look like this:
This example shows that 75% of your original customers continued subscribing, providing insight into the platform’s performance.

KPI 3: Net Promoter Score (NPS)
Definition
NPS is a metric that quantifies how likely your clients are to recommend your Credit Risk Assessment Solutions. It plays a critical role in evaluating client satisfaction and overall loyalty for platforms like CreditSense Analytics. Advantages
- Provides an immediate measure of client satisfaction and loyalty, crucial for customer retention.
- Helps identify key areas for improving customer service and support efficiency.
- Enhances decision-making for revenue growth by reflecting genuine client feedback influenced by machine learning algorithms.
Disadvantages
- May not capture the full spectrum of client feedback and nuances in satisfaction.
- Results can be sensitive to the survey design and timing.
- Potentially influenced by small sample sizes, affecting the reliability of the metric.
Industry Benchmarks
In the credit risk management sector, industry benchmarks for NPS typically range between 20 and 30 for companies with moderate satisfaction levels, while leading firms can achieve scores above 50. These benchmarks are vital for assessing both client satisfaction and investor confidence.
How To Improve
- Regularly collect and analyze customer feedback to pinpoint service gaps.
- Enhance onboarding and support processes to solidify client trust.
- Integrate qualitative insights with quantitative data for deeper understanding of customer sentiments.
How To Calculate
NPS is calculated by subtracting the percentage of detractors from the percentage of promoters. Use the following formula:
Example of Calculation
If 60% of respondents are promoters and 20% are detractors, the NPS is calculated as follows:
Here, a score of 40 indicates relatively strong client relationships, often correlating with higher customer retention and improved revenue growth. KPI 5: Data Processing Time
Definition
Data Processing Time measures the average duration it takes to process and analyze data inputs across your system. It plays a key role in evaluating operational efficiency and is crucial for timely insights that support data-driven decision making and enhanced customer satisfaction.
Advantages
- Boosts operational efficiency by ensuring swift data analysis.
- Enhances customer satisfaction, critical for subscription-based models like CreditSense Analytics.
- Drives investor confidence by consistently delivering timely insights to support credit risk management.
Disadvantages
- Can be affected by inefficient data sources or outdated algorithms.
- May be misinterpreted if not compared against industry benchmarks.
- High variability in processing time can lead to misleading operational insights.
Industry Benchmarks
In the realm of credit risk assessment solutions, industry benchmarks for Data Processing Time typically range between 1-3 seconds for real-time systems. These standards are essential for identifying underwriting inefficiencies and ensuring your platform meets client expectations.
How To Improve
- Optimize machine learning algorithms for faster data processing.
- Upgrade infrastructure to reduce latency and boost throughput.
- Refine data integration methods to minimize redundant processing steps.
How To Calculate
Data Processing Time is calculated by dividing the total processing duration by the number of processed data sets. This provides an average processing time that indicates system performance.
Example of Calculation
If your platform, like CreditSense Analytics, processes a total of 200 seconds over 100 data sets, then the average Data Processing Time is computed as follows:
This example highlights that a 2-second processing time supports timely decision-making and enhances operational efficiency.
